What “Cookies” Are and How They Are Used

“Cookies” are simple text files that web browsers place on computer hard drives when sites are visited. Cookies cannot damage files, nor can they read information from a user’s hard drive. The cookie, by itself, doesn’t tell us your e-mail address or who you are. When you participate in our activities, we do not store any personal information within cookies, nor do we link or combine information collected through cookies to any personal information submitted online. Publisher uses cookies to help us measure the number of visits, average time spent, page views, and other statistics relating to use of our sites. As a convenience for users, Publisher also uses cookies to remember non-personally identifiable user-names so that the need for multiple log-ins is eliminated.

Please note certain features on our sites may not function if you do not accept cookies.
